AirLive EtherWe-1000U Ethernet Adapter PDF Print
Written by Sanjin Maneslovic   
Monday, 16 June 2008
ImageAirLive is helping thousands of gamers unleashing the full power of their WiiTM gaming systems by connecting their WiiTM console to the Internet, using AirLive EtherWe-1000U Adapter. This is the easiest and cheap method for you to connect your WiiTM console to the Internet.


Designed to be compatible with WiiTM, AirLive EtherWe-1000U is 100% plug-and-play. Internet connection is achieved instantly by connecting AirLive EtherWe-1000U to the USB port of the WiiTM, no additional setups are needed. Another advantage AirLive EtherWe-1000U has over WiiTM built-in WiFi Connection is that it does not require a wireless router to work. AirLive EtherWe-1000U can be connected directly to an ADSL Modem or Router. With a transfer rate of up to 100Mbps, AirLive EtherWe-1000U is about 2 times faster than WiiTM built-in WiFi connection. When the WiiTM is connected to the Internet, there will be additional Wii Channels for the whole family to enjoy.

Gamers can now play online games such as FIFA 08 or Chess with other gamers half the globe away. The WiiTM is also an Information Center providing news and weather forecast via the News and Forecast Channels respectively. The Wii Shop Channel allows users to download classic Nintendo Entertainment System (NES) games and newly added Wii Channels.
